2017-01-14 35 views
0

我:Django的filebrowser '錯誤發現上傳,文件夾'

  • 的Django 1.8.2
  • Django的格拉佩利2.7.3
  • Django的filebrowser 3.6.4
  • Django的TinyMCE的2.4.0

INSTALLED_APPS

INSTALLED_APPS = (
    'grappelli', 
    'filebrowser', 
    'django.contrib.admin', 

urlpatterns

from filebrowser.sites import site 

urlpatterns = patterns[ 
    url(r'^admin/filebrowser/', include(site.urls)), 
    url(r'^grappelli/', include('grappelli.urls')), 
    url(r'^tinymce/', include('tinymce.urls')), 
    url(r'^admin/', include(admin.site.urls)), 
] 

這似乎正常工作。

我的MEDIA_ROOT設置爲'D:\\sites\\my_site\\public_html\\media\\'

FILEBROWSER_DIRECTORY = 'D:\\sites\\my_site\\public_html\\media\\'組也在我的設置,但在瀏覽http://localhost:8000/admin/filebrowser/browse/仍然得到一個錯誤:

ImproperlyConfigured at /admin/filebrowser/browse/ 

Error finding Upload-Folder (site.storage.location + site.directory). Maybe it does not exist? 

回答

3

事情是DIRECTORY在filebrowser.settings默認設置爲uploads/。所以,只是在我的設置做了

FILEBROWSER_DIRECTORY = '' 
DIRECTORY = '' 

和現在的作品使用MEDIA_ROOT,因爲我是expexting。

或者一個只是可以創建uploads目錄MEDIA_ROOT內使其工作。

相關問題